Output 77ea7ddf360ec4fd1ecb8ae4dcb03942791768b9fe4d7e2127902da31b384134:1

value
19351377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d886e28414bfcaf5adf56830b24db7a1f4329eb OP_EQUALVERIFY OP_CHECKSIG
address
1DuMiPiUM1Wu5aoapB6TXkRFVvjTNxFsDC
transaction
77ea7ddf360ec4fd1ecb8ae4dcb03942791768b9fe4d7e2127902da31b384134
spent
true